[clc-devel] [CRUX] #82: QT-3.3.5 fails to build with mysql on i386
#82: QT-3.3.5 fails to build with mysql on i386 --------------------+------------------------------------------------------- Id: 82 | Status: new Component: ports | Modified: Fri Feb 10 17:49:07 2006 Severity: minor | Milestone: Priority: normal | Version: 2.0 Owner: danm | Reporter: ningo@scripternet.org --------------------+------------------------------------------------------- [...] {{{ g++ -fno-exceptions -Wl,-rpath,/home/ports/wrk/src/qt-x11-free-3.3.5/lib -o ../../../bin/uic .obj/release-shared-mt/main.o .obj/release-shared- mt/uic.o .obj/re lease-shared-mt/form.o .obj/release-shared-mt/object.o .obj/release- shared-mt/subclassing.o .obj/release-shared-mt/embed.o .obj/release- shared-mt/widgetdatabase .o .obj/release-shared-mt/domtool.o .obj/release-shared-mt/parser.o -L/usr/lib/mysql -L/home/ports/wrk/src/qt-x11-free-3.3.5/lib -L/usr/X11R6/lib -L/usr/X11R 6/lib -lqt-mt -lz -lGLU -lGL -lXmu -lXi -lXrender -lXrandr -lXcursor -lXinerama -lXft -lfreetype -lfontconfig -lXext -lX11 -lm -lSM -lICE -ldl -lpthread /usr/bin/ld: warning: libmysqlclient.so.14, needed by /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so, not found (try using -rpath or -rpath-link) /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_fetch_field_direct@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_list_tables@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_init@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_store_result@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_escape_string@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_server_end@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_use_result@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_real_query@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_free_result@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_fetch_row@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_real_connect@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_server_init@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_num_rows@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_fetch_lengths@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_query@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_field_count@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_affected_rows@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_list_fields@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_fetch_field@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_field_seek@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_errno@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_data_seek@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_close@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_error@libmysqlclient_14' /home/ports/wrk/src/qt-x11-free-3.3.5/lib/libqt-mt.so: undefined reference to `mysql_select_db@libmysqlclient_14' collect2: ld returned 1 exit status [...] =======> ERROR: Building '/home/ports/pkg/qt3#3.3.5-1.pkg.tar.gz' failed. -- Packages where update failed qt3 Real: 2298.20s User: 1633.81s System: 61.88s Percent: 73% Cmd: sudo prt- get sysup % }}} -- Ticket URL: <http://crux.nu/cgi-bin/trac.cgi/ticket/82> CRUX <http://crux.nu/> CRUX
#82: QT-3.3.5 fails to build with mysql on i386 --------------------+------------------------------------------------------- Id: 82 | Status: new Component: ports | Modified: Fri Feb 10 17:52:00 2006 Severity: minor | Milestone: Priority: normal | Version: 2.0 Owner: danm | Reporter: ningo@scripternet.org --------------------+------------------------------------------------------- Comment (by jw): Kinda looks like you're missing the entry in /etc/ld.so.conf (see mysql's README), since it obviously compiled but just failed to link -- Ticket URL: <http://crux.nu/cgi-bin/trac.cgi/ticket/82> CRUX <http://crux.nu/> CRUX
#82: QT-3.3.5 fails to build with mysql on i386 --------------------+------------------------------------------------------- Id: 82 | Status: closed Component: ports | Modified: Mon Feb 13 09:04:10 2006 Severity: minor | Milestone: Priority: normal | Version: 2.0 Owner: danm | Reporter: ningo@scripternet.org --------------------+------------------------------------------------------- Changes (by anonymous): * resolution: => invalid * status: new => closed -- Ticket URL: <https://crux.nu/cgi-bin/trac.cgi/ticket/82> CRUX <http://crux.nu/> CRUX
participants (1)
-
CRUX